在UIPageViewController中停止卷页动画是因为UIPageViewController是一个用于实现页面滚动效果的控制器,它的主要作用是管理多个视图控制器之间的切换。卷页动画是UIPageViewController的默认滚动效果,它使得用户可以通过水平滑动来切换页面。
然而,UIPageViewController并没有提供直接停止卷页动画的方法。这是因为卷页动画是UIPageViewController的核心特性之一,停止卷页动画可能会破坏UIPageViewController的设计初衷,导致用户体验不佳。
如果你希望停止卷页动画,可以考虑使用其他方式来实现页面切换效果,例如使用UIScrollView或自定义的滚动视图控制器。这样你就可以完全控制页面切换的动画效果,包括停止动画、自定义动画等。
总结起来,不能在UIPageViewController中停止卷页动画是因为它的设计初衷是实现页面滚动效果,停止动画可能会破坏用户体验。如果需要停止动画,可以考虑使用其他方式来实现页面切换效果。
领取专属 10元无门槛券
手把手带您无忧上云